Hampton Vinyl is your best source.They make OEM type replacements.Not the crappy under $100(or whatever price)slip on covers that merely go over the factory seats.Hamptons are "fake" leather, but good imitation & require you to remove the originals.They go on the same way as the OEM.You can also try a local upholstery shop.

Just as the guys mentioned above, the covers you were looking at on eBay are just covers that slip over your existing covers. There is no way that those covers are going to fit snug tight if your putting them over your existing seats. Believe me, I do this for a living and I know. The covers I make actually replace your old covers. You take your old covers completely off your seats and put the brand new ones on I make. If the foam in your seats is still good and puffed up, the covers I make will fit very tight just like the pictures you see on my website. Remember you always get what you pay for. The Ultra Leather and Hampton Vinyl is very very good durable stuff and looks just like the genuine leather which is so expensive to buy, but I can get it if your wanting to pay for genuine leather.
